Adicionar cabeçalho ao PDF via C#

Adicione cabeçalho ao arquivo PDF usando a biblioteca C#.

Adicionar cabeçalhos ao documento PDF usando a biblioteca C#

Para adicionar Header em PDF, usaremos a API Aspose.PDF for .NET, que é uma API de manipulação de documentos rica em recursos, poderosa e fácil de usar para a plataforma net. Abra o gerenciador de pacotes NuGet, procure por Aspose.pdf e instale. Você também pode usar o seguinte comando no Console do Gerenciador de Pacotes.

Package Manager Console

PM > Install-Package Aspose.PDF

Etapas para adicionar cabeçalho ao PDF via C#


Você precisa Aspose.PDF for .NET testar o código em seu ambiente.

  1. Abra um documento PDF usando o objeto Document.
  2. Crie um carimbo e defina suas propriedades.
  3. Adicione o carimbo à página usando o método addStamp.
  4. Salve o arquivo PDF.

Adicione um cabeçalho ao documento PDF - C#

Este exemplo de código mostra como adicionar cabeçalho ao PDF


    // Open document
    Document pdfDocument = new Document(dataDir+ "TextinHeader.pdf");

    // Create header
    TextStamp textStamp = new TextStamp("Header Text");
    // Set properties of the stamp
    textStamp.TopMargin = 10;
    textStamp.HorizontalAlignment = HorizontalAlignment.Center;
    textStamp.VerticalAlignment = VerticalAlignment.Top;
    // Add header on all pages
    foreach (Page page in pdfDocument.Pages)
    {
        page.AddStamp(textStamp);
    }

    // Save updated document
    pdfDocument.Save(dataDir+ "TextinHeader_out.pdf");